What is the life expectancy in Somalia 2020?

What is the life expectancy in Somalia 2020?

57.50 years
The life expectancy for Somalia in 2020 was 57.50 years, a 0.49% increase from 2019. The life expectancy for Somalia in 2019 was 57.22 years, a 0.49% increase from 2018. The life expectancy for Somalia in 2018 was 56.94 years, a 0.74% increase from 2017.

Why does Somalia have a low life expectancy?

As a direct consequence of famine, disease and violence, the life expectancy of the average Somali is extremely low. In addition, diseases like malaria continue to harm the population.

What is Somalia’s death rate 2020?

10.5 per 1,000 people
In 2020, death rate for Somalia was 10.5 per 1,000 people. Death rate of Somalia fell gradually from 22.8 per 1,000 people in 1971 to 10.5 per 1,000 people in 2020. What is death rate? Crude death rate indicates the number of deaths occurring during the year, per 1,000 population estimated at midyear.

What religion is practiced in Somalia?

According to the federal Ministry of Religious Affairs, more than 99 percent of the Somali population is Sunni Muslim. Members of other religious groups combined constitute less than 1 percent of the population, and include a small Christian community, a small Sufi community, and an unknown number of Shia Muslims.

Does Somalia have a high death rate?

According to data from UNICEF, the likelihood of dying before the age of 5 in Somalia is 13.7 percent and are one of the highest in the world. The leading causes of these deaths include pneumonia at 24 percent, diarrhea at 19 percent and measles at 12 percent.

What’s the life expectancy of a male in Somalia?

Top 10 Facts About Life Expectancy in Somalia. In 2018, the life expectancy for a male was 53.7 years and the life expectancy for a female was 57.3 years, according to the World Health Organization (WHO).

Why are so many people dying in Somalia?

The leading causes of these deaths include pneumonia at 24 percent, diarrhea at 19 percent and measles at 12 percent. Undernutrition is an underlying factor in one-third of deaths before age 5 in Somalia. According to the Global Hunger Index, around 50.6 percent of the population has insufficient access to calories.

Which is the mother language of the Somali people?

Languages. Somali and Arabic are the official languages of Somalia. The Somali language is the mother tongue of the Somali people, the nation’s most populous ethnic group. It is a member of the Cushitic branch of the Afro-Asiatic language family, and its nearest relatives are the Oromo, Afar and Saho languages.
